Investing in people is one of the most meaningful ways to build sustainable communities and a stronger industrial sector. Through its Skills Development Programme, Chromtech Holdings is helping young South Africans gain the technical training, confidence, and support needed to pursue skilled careers.

Two of the programme’s current learners, Kgomotso Mdupe and Sandile Ndamase, demonstrate how access to education and mentorship can transform opportunity into real progress.

Building a Future as an Electrician

Originally from an area outside Brits, Kgomotso Mdupe is currently training to become an electrician through a full Chromtech bursary. The scholarship covers her tuition, accommodation, transport and provides a monthly stipend, allowing her to focus fully on her studies and training.

For Kgomotso, the experience has been about far more than learning technical skills. She describes the programme as a journey of personal growth. Through her studies she has built confidence, formed strong friendships, and developed a deeper sense of independence and self-worth.

As she progresses in her training, she hopes to use her skills to build a stable career while inspiring other young women to consider technical trades.

Learning the Trade of a Fitter

For Sandile Ndamase, the appeal of engineering has always been the hands-on work. Now in his first year of training as a fitter, Sandile is completing his practical learning at Limberg Mining Company, working alongside experienced artisans and learning the realities of the trade on site.

The exposure to real industrial environments has strengthened his interest in the field. Sandile sees the programme not just as a qualification, but as the first step in a much longer professional journey.

Once he completes his training, he hopes to continue his studies in mechanical engineering and build a career that combines practical skills with advanced technical knowledge.

Creating Pathways Through Skills Development

For both learners, the opportunity provided by Chromtech Holdings represents far more than training for a specific trade. It is a pathway to further education, long-term career opportunities, and the ability to actively shape their own futures.

By investing in young artisans, Chromtech’s Skills Development Programme is helping strengthen the country’s technical workforce while creating meaningful opportunities for individuals who are ready to build, learn and lead.
